Cricket Infestation: Signs, Causes, and Prevention

Dealing with a infestation can be annoying . Identifying the first signs is crucial . Look for the noise particularly at night , damaged plants , and these little bugs – often found near foundations . Several factors contribute to cricket infestations , including excessive humidity, overgrown plants , and click here cluttered areas . Avoiding problems involve improving drainage , clearing vegetation , patching holes in your home's foundation , and maintaining cleanliness . You might also consider natural repellents or calling an exterminator if the problem persists.

Ways to Dealing with Indoor Pests : Effective Pest Removal

Dealing with unwanted house crickets can be irritating . Thankfully, several methods exist for eliminating these insects . First, thoroughly check your home's foundation, windows, and doors for cracks – seal them with weatherstripping. Then , eliminate moisture levels by repairing any drips and using a moisture remover . Keep your outdoor area clean , as this can draw crickets. Think about using insect traps to catch crickets. Finally , you may consider insecticide specifically for crickets, reading label directions carefully . Prevention is key for avoiding future infestations.
